Event narrative

Numerous trees were felled by thunderstorm winds within the confines of Fall Creek Falls State Park boundaries. Satellite photos indicate the swath extended into Bledsoe County with additional trees over a wide area knocked down by powerful straight line winds.

Wider weather episode

A highly anomalous pattern for August including an unseasonably intense low pressure system created several hours of severe thunderstorms including the final round of storms that grew upscale into a severe mesoscale convective system.
